VINKOVCI/VUKOVAR, Oct 31 (Hina) - Croatian Radio Vukovar suspended
its move from Vinkovci to Vukovar, as its directors disapproved of a
transmitter of Serb Radio Vukovar being installed on the top of the
building housing the Croatian radio offices.
The Croatian radio offices are located on the top floor of an 11-
storey hotel in the suburb of Borovo.
The one-kW transmitter of the Serb radio is being set on the roof of
the building, just above the offices of the Croatian radio, which
will jam Croatian radio broadcasts, director Zeljko Fekete said on
Friday.
"Until the transmitter has not been relocated, Croatian Radio
Vukovar will not begin broadcasting from Vukovar," Fekete said.
Zdravko Dumencic, a Croatian Radio and Television (HTV) worker
installing the transmitter, stressed that it would not jam Croatian
Radio Vukovar transmissions, adding that the transmitter would be
relocated in about 15 days.
Croatian Radio Vukovar began moving back to the Danube river town on
28 October and was expected to resume broadcasting from it in early
November.
